While in this area, players can access different portals which act as access points to different in-game worlds that have varying stages of progression. Players take on one of the multiple classes that each have different play styles and abilities before they are transported to an area called “The Hub”. Trove is the first game on this list of the best free action games you can play, and it’s a game with a bunch of great aspects. World of Tanks Blitz isn’t that competitive either (even though it does consist of tournaments) and is more directed at people who have the time and the patience to succeed. This is almost a watered-down version of the highly acclaimed World of Tanks series and is mainly for casual gamers instead of those who play it instead of sleep. This is one of the many cross-platform free action games, and one of the best that is dedicated to fierce combat and a selection of formidable vehicles. We’ve all played zombie survival games in the past and this is one that has very few real ideas of its own, but its simplicity and the fact that it’s a very accessible survival simulator is something that players can get behind. Unturned is a free action game that features several different game modes, all of which consist of the same basic concept of zombie survival.
